As CP 100 flew through Baxter with CP 8757 on point, they asked RTC about potential foremen on the tracks south of them. RTCs response was that they were &#8220;everywhere&#8221; and CP 100 immediately got to work contacting the foremen along the line to make sure the track was clear. Once everyone was off the tracks (foremen had work blocks from Spence to Bolton), CP 100 blasts through Palgrave, the K5LA on CP 8757 singing happily.
